Output 98a10c3e7bc3ca5247bed7ef54b2fcb6e48c1212550c07eb79ab111d70d191bb:1

value
1867022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81df1faf88f9e72adc8452a9ec03a069a14bdfbe OP_EQUAL
address
3DXiPCdcQeJX23b46ceDirHBn9QsvMHHLc
transaction
98a10c3e7bc3ca5247bed7ef54b2fcb6e48c1212550c07eb79ab111d70d191bb
confirmations
328965
spent
true